Back to Benchmark Email in Excel
SheetXAI logo
Benchmark Email logo
Benchmark Email · Excel Guide

Compare Contacts Across Benchmark Email Lists to Find Overlaps

The Scenario

You are a list manager at a media company. You run a newsletter list and a promotional list in Benchmark Email, two of your six total lists. The newsletter list has 14,000 subscribers. The promotional list has 9,000.

You are planning a re-engagement campaign that should only go to newsletter-only subscribers. To build the right audience, you need to know who appears in both lists and suppress them.

Your only tool is an Excel workbook, saved to SharePoint.

The slow version:

  • Export newsletter list as CSV, paste emails into column A
  • Export promotional list as CSV, paste emails into column B
  • Write a COUNTIF to find overlaps
  • Filter to duplicates, tag them for suppression
  • The workbook has 14,000 rows and VLOOKUP is crawling and you are questioning everything.

The fast version is one prompt.

The Easy Way: One Prompt in SheetXAI

SheetXAI is an AI agent inside your Excel workbook that pulls both contact lists from Benchmark Email and runs the overlap analysis for you, without a CSV export or a formula in sight.

Open the SheetXAI sidebar and type:

Compare contacts across Benchmark Email list IDs in column A of my workbook. Find every email address that appears in more than one list. Write the overlapping emails and their list memberships into a new tab called Overlaps — one row per shared contact, with their email, name, and a comma-separated list of which lists they appear in.

SheetXAI pulls the contacts from all list IDs in column A, identifies the overlaps, and writes the results into the Overlaps tab. You get a clean suppression list without touching a CSV.

What You Get

A completed overlap analysis in the Overlaps tab:

  • Email address — one row per contact who appears in more than one list
  • Name — first and last name from Benchmark Email
  • Lists column — comma-separated list of which list IDs each contact belongs to
  • Row count — the total tells you exactly how many contacts to suppress

The suppression list is ready to use. Share the SharePoint link with the campaign team.

What If the Data Is Not Quite Ready

When you need contacts exclusive to one list

Pull all contacts from Benchmark Email list IDs in column A. Write contacts who appear only in list ID 1122 and not in list ID 3344 into a tab called Newsletter Only. Write overlapping contacts into a tab called Overlaps. One row per contact in each tab.

When email casing is inconsistent across lists

Pull contacts from all Benchmark Email list IDs in column A. Before comparing, normalize all email addresses to lowercase. Write overlapping contacts (based on normalized email) into the Overlaps tab. Write the original casing from each list into separate columns for reference.

When you need to compare all six lists at once

Pull contacts from all Benchmark Email list IDs in column A. For each unique email, write a row into the All Contacts tab showing the email, name, and a "1" or "0" in separate columns for each list ID — one column per list. That gives me a presence matrix I can filter any direction.

When you want the overlap analysis plus the campaign-ready send list

Pull contacts from Benchmark Email list IDs 1122 and 3344. Write contacts who appear in both lists into the Suppression tab — just email addresses, one per row, no header. Write contacts who appear only in list 1122 into the Send List tab with email, first name, and last name.

The pattern: describe the output you actually need — suppression file and send list — and let SheetXAI build both from the same API calls.

Try It

Get the 7-day free trial of SheetXAI and open a workbook with Benchmark Email list IDs in column A, then ask SheetXAI to run the cross-list overlap analysis. The Benchmark Email integration is included in every SheetXAI plan. See also how to export contacts for deduplication in Excel or the Benchmark Email in Excel overview.

Stop memorizing formulas.
Tell your spreadsheet what to do.

Join 4,000+ professionals saving hours every week with SheetXAI.

Learn more